Sales Market Trends
The last sale on Scotswood Close sold for £2,180,000 on 25th January 2023. Since then prices are down an average of 5.2%.
The current average value in the street is £2,089,410.
The Scotswood Close Sales Market has increased by 20.9% over the last 10 years.
| Period | Year on Year | Average Price |
|---|---|---|
| July 2026 | -2.4% | £2,089,410 |
| July 2025 | -0.3% | £2,141,095 |
| July 2024 | -2% | £2,147,200 |
| July 2023 | -1.2% | £2,191,319 |
| July 2022 | 8.8% | £2,217,049 |
| July 2021 | 7.3% | £2,036,911 |
| July 2020 | 3.2% | £1,898,265 |
| July 2019 | -0.7% | £1,839,090 |
| July 2018 | 4.8% | £1,852,317 |
| July 2017 | 2.2% | £1,766,811 |
| July 2016 | -0.3% | £1,727,971 |
| July 2015 | 5.4% | £1,733,813 |
| July 2014 | 9.1% | £1,644,606 |
| July 2013 | 2.8% | £1,506,981 |
| July 2012 | 0.4% | £1,466,615 |
| July 2011 | 7.7% | £1,461,463 |
| July 2010 | 14.5% | £1,356,430 |
| July 2009 | -5% | £1,184,712 |
| July 2008 | 1.5% | £1,247,500 |
| July 2007 | 0% | £1,229,391 |
